Title: Suhit Ranjan Das: Innovator in Laser Diode Technology

Introduction

Suhit Ranjan Das is a prominent inventor based in West Windsor, NJ (US). He has made significant contributions to the field of laser technology, holding 2 patents that showcase his innovative approach to semiconductor laser diodes.

Latest Patents

One of his latest patents is for a low current, high power laser diode bar. This invention includes a semiconductor substrate with a first semiconductor layer of a first conductivity type. It features a first laser diode stack and a second laser diode stack, which are electrically connected in series. The design ensures that the electrical conductivity of the first semiconductor layer is higher than that of the semiconductor layers in the laser diode stacks. Another notable patent involves laterally tailoring current injection for laser diodes. This semiconductor laser diode consists of multiple layers stacked in a specific direction, including an optical waveguide that defines a resonant cavity for generating laser light. The resistivity profile of at least one layer varies gradually, enhancing the performance of the laser diode.
